“Paranormal Activity 2” trailer debuts online
 

The first teaser trailer for the sequel of the surprise horror blockbuster “Paranormal Activity” has debuted online on Wednesday.

The original film was made with a budget of only $15,000 and is now close to earning $200 million worldwide. It was like a Cinderella story for director Oren Peli and the cast and crew.

It was first announced that Kevin Greutert will direct the sequel because Peli was tasked to work on a new horror flick called “Area 51.” But Greutert has contractual obligations to direct the latest “Saw” film called “Saw VII 3-D,” so he was replaced by Tod “Kip” Williams.

It is still not sure whether the sequel will feature the same cast. Actress Katie Featherston said, “I don’t know. I’m waiting to hear. If they had a way to put me in there in a way that would be reasonable and make sense – I don’t know how they’d do that – I’d definitely be down for it. If I get that phone call, I will be there. I will be scared or happy or whatever they want me to be.”

However, actor Micah Sloat appeared to know more. He said, “I know a lot I can’t tell you. All I can tell you is I’m very excited for the project, it’s really cool, it’s gonna be really interesting and it’s not gonna suck, which most horror sequels … would. This is gonna be good.”
